Hiccup

"A Fleeting Twitch Upon the Face"

By AbbasPublished 2 years ago 1 min read
Hiccup
Photo by Caleb Woods on Unsplash

A sudden jolt, a tiny gasp,

A hiccup's grip, a gentle clasp,

Unexpected, out of place,

In midst of quiet, calm, and peace,

It stirs the air, brings soft release,

A rhythm broken, time askew,

A playful glitch, a moment new.

Laughter follows, light and free,

As hiccups dance spontaneously,

Annoying yet endearing too,

A quirky pulse that we pursue.

The body’s way of saying, "Pause,"

A mystery without a cause,

A reminder life’s not always planned,

In every hiccup, joy is spanned.

For in these little interruptions,

Life finds its simplest eruptions,

Hiccups come and soon they go,

Tiny ripples in life's flow.
